Quick answer

Pale leaves on Begonia maculata (polka dot begonia, angel wing begonia) look washed-out, yellow-green, or flat light green instead of the crisp dark-green upper surface with bright silver dots this cane begonia is known for. For general chlorosis mechanics, see our pale leaves guide. On maculata, faded silver spotting plus internode spacing on upright red canes tells you whether light, wet roots, pests, or nutrients is the limiter—not a generic houseplant chlorosis checklist.

First step: compare the newest leaves at the cane tip with foliage two or three nodes lower. Uniform pale washout with long gaps between leaf pairs and dull dots means move to brighter indirect light before you feed. Pale lowers on a heavy wet pot with limp petioles belongs on the overwatering branch. Fine pale speckling with webbing on undersides routes to spider mites—not fertilizer.

What pale leaves look like on Begonia Maculata

Healthy maculata shows angel-wing shaped blades on upright red cane stems: dark olive-green uppers with crisp silver polka dots, wine-red undersides, and new growth opening from nodes near the cane tips. Pale foliage breaks that signature in patterns that map to specific fixes.

Low-light chlorosis (most common indoors)

  • Uniform washed-out yellow-green across several leaves—not isolated spots
  • Silver polka dots lose contrast; the upper surface looks flat dark green or lime instead of crisp green-and-silver
  • Smaller, thinner new leaves at cane tips compared with older growth from a brighter period
  • Long internodes between leaf pairs as stems reach toward the window—see leggy growth
  • Plant leans hard toward the brightest side of the room
  • Soil may stay wet longer than expected because the plant is not using water in dim light
  • Plants not receiving enough light often have light green foliage and stretch toward the source

Direct-sun washout (too much light)

  • Upper leaf surfaces bleach to pale green or yellow-green on the window-facing side
  • Silver dots fade or disappear on sun-struck blades—too much direct sun can wash out polka dot color
  • May pair with crispy brown patches on the same sun-exposed tissue
  • Undersides on shaded portions of the blade may still look normal red
  • Different from low light: damage is one-sided toward the pane, not uniform dim-room etiolation

Nutrient washout on fast-growing canes

  • Older mid-cane leaves pale first while newest tips stay slightly greener—at least briefly—on an otherwise well-lit plant
  • Appears after months without feed during spring and summer active growth in the same small pot
  • Stems stay firm; no webbing; soil dries on a normal schedule per the watering guide
  • Nitrogen deficiency on mobile nutrients often hits lowers before tips
  • New leaves pale with dark green veins on older canes points toward iron deficiency—confirm before guessing nitrogen

Normal lower-cane fading before yellow drop

  • One or two lowest angel-wing leaves lighten to pale green, then yellow, on an otherwise healthy tall cane
  • Upper spotted growth stays crisp; internodes on new sections look normal
  • Slow over weeks on an established plant—different from sudden whole-plant washout
  • Snip spent blades once firm; not the same crisis as pale new tips on wet soil

Why Begonia Maculata gets pale leaves

Polka dot begonia is a cane begonia from Brazilian Atlantic rainforest understory—it needs bright, filtered light to maintain leaf pigment and the silver dot pattern. Cane-like begonias such as maculata like brighter light and will grow weak and lanky in dim corners; pale foliage is often the first visible sign before full yellow leaves appear.

Low light plus slow water use is a common indoor failure mode. In a dim room the top 2–3 cm of mix may stay wet for two weeks while the plant cannot photosynthesize enough to support pigment—pale blades and soggy roots compound. That pairing is more dangerous on begonias than on succulents because begonias want moist but well-drained compost, not a constantly saturated dim corner.

Overwatering damages fibrous roots so uptake fails even when fertilizer is present—chlorosis on mid-cane leaves follows. Harvest-style nitrogen depletion is less common than on herbs, but maculata in the same pot for years without spring feed can pale older leaves while pushing new tips. Spider mites thrive in the warm dry air above radiators where maculata often sits for light—stippling mimics pale chlorosis until you check undersides.

Too much direct sun is maculata-specific among pale-leaf causes: owners move a dim plant suddenly to harsh south glass and bleach the polka dots off the sun-facing side. Diffuse bright indirect light—not midday sun on angel-wing blades—is the target from the light guide.

How to confirm the cause

Work through these checks in order:

  1. Newest leaf color and internode spacing - Compare the last two leaf pairs at the cane tip with pairs from six months ago. Pale tips plus widening gaps confirm light stress before nutrient guesses.
  2. Silver dot contrast - Hold a healthy photo reference or an older leaf from the same plant. Faded uniform dots across many blades support chlorosis; one-sided bleaching on window-facing tissue supports sun washout.
  3. Pot weight and top 2–3 cm moisture - Heavy cool pot with damp clinging mix routes to wet-root pale. Light pot with dry upper soil and slightly limp pale leaves may fit underwatering—less common but possible in bright heat.
  4. Window direction and distance - East or west within about two feet is the usual indoor target. North-only or more than six feet from glass rarely sustains crisp spotting on maculata.
  5. Leaf undersides and axils - Webbing, stippling, or mealy white cotton means pests—not fertilizer. Wipe a white paper towel under a leaf; reddish streaks on mites confirm.
  6. Feed and repot history - Months of active growth without dilute feed in the same container supports nitrogen washout only after light and moisture look correct.

If checks point to wet soil, read overwatering before adding nutrients. If the plant is pale in a dim corner with wet mix, fix light and dry-down together—either alone leaves the other stressor active.

First fix for Begonia Maculata

Your first fix depends on what the six checks confirmed—pick one path before stacking treatments.

If new leaves are pale with wide internodes in a dim spot

Move the pot to your brightest safe indirect-light location—typically within a couple of feet of an east- or west-facing window where hot midday sun never hits the foliage. Give it two weeks and read the next new leaves for darker green and stronger silver dots. This is the same first move as not enough light—do not fertilize a dim pale plant hoping to green it up.

If the pot is heavy and the top mix is wet

Stop all watering until the top 2–3 cm of mix dries and the pot feels noticeably lighter. Wet-root chlorosis will not resolve with feed while roots sit saturated. Follow the dry-down protocol in overwatering.

If sun-facing blades bleached but the rest of the plant looks normal

Shift the pot back from direct sun or add a sheer curtain so light stays bright but diffused. Do not move a stressed plant into deeper shade—that trades one pale cause for another.

If only older mid-cane leaves are pale, light is good, and soil dries on schedule

Apply dilute balanced liquid fertilizer at half strength once during active spring or summer growth, then wait four weeks. Skip feed in winter or on a recently repotted plant. Confirm the pattern matches nitrogen deficiency before repeating.

If you find stippling, webbing, or dusty undersides

Isolate the plant and treat the confirmed pest before adjusting fertilizer or repotting. Pest pale spots will not green up with watering tweaks alone.

Do not repot, mist heavily, or prune half the cane on day one unless inspection shows mushy roots, blocked drainage, or a pest infestation that requires it.

Recovery timeline

Fully washed-out angel-wing leaves will not regain crisp silver dots or deep green color. Remove the worst pale blades once canes stabilize so energy goes to new spotted growth from nodes.

Stabilization after correcting the primary stressor—usually one to two weeks once light improves or wet soil dries on schedule. Pale washout should slow; canes should stay firm.

New spotted leaves unfurling from cane tips are the best success signal. Expect them in three to eight weeks during warm active growth, sometimes longer if recovery started in a cool winter room. Judge success by new growth, not old leaf color.

Worsening signs: pale tips on continuously wet soil, lowest cane softening after dry-down, stippling spreading despite watering fixes, or whole-plant washout within days on saturated mix—those need root rot inspection or pest treatment, not patience alone.

What not to do

Do not fertilize a pale maculata in a dim corner—salt stress and weak uptake both pale foliage, and feed on stressed roots slows recovery. Do not water more because pale leaves look limp while soil is already wet; that converts chlorosis into rot.

Avoid moving a dim pale plant straight onto hot south glass to “fix light”—diffuse brightness gradually. Do not mist heavily as a humidity substitute; wet spotted foliage in stagnant air invites powdery mildew on begonias. Do not assume every pale lower leaf is aging when the pot is heavy and new tips are also washed out.

When trimming pale leaves or handling wet mix, wear gloves and wash hands after—Begonia species are toxic to cats and dogs.

How to prevent pale leaves on Begonia Maculata

Match care to cane begonia biology: RHS cane begonia guidance calls for moist but well-drained compost, partial shade, and moderate humidity—not a constantly wet dim corner.

Provide bright indirect light per the Begonia Maculata light guide so silver dots stay crisp and the mix dries predictably. Water on soil checks, not calendar dates—allow the top 2–3 cm to dry before the next drink. Keep RH at or above 50% at leaf height in heated dry months; see low humidity when margins crisp before full washout.

Feed lightly every two to four weeks at half strength during active growth only after basics are right. Rotate the pot a quarter turn weekly so all cane sides receive even light. Inspect undersides monthly for mites in warm dry rooms. Flush salts occasionally if you fertilize frequently in small pots.

Conclusion

Pale leaves on Begonia Maculata reward a simple diagnostic order: read the silver dots and newest cane growth first, then pot weight versus light exposure, then pests and nutrients. Faded polka dots with stretched internodes almost always mean brighter indirect light—not another splash of water. When mid-cane blades wash out on a heavy wet pot, dry the root zone before you feed. Polka dot begonia forgives one spent pale lower leaf far more willingly than it forgives a dim, saturated pot left on autopilot.

Frequently asked questions

Why are the silver polka dots fading on my Begonia Maculata?

Faded silver spotting is a hallmark of light stress on maculata. Too little light dulls the contrast between green and silver; too much direct sun can bleach the upper surface and wash spots away. Check window distance and whether new leaves emerge smaller and farther apart on the cane—that pattern fits low light before nutrient deficiency.

Is pale foliage the same as yellow leaves on polka dot begonia?

Pale is a washed-out yellow-green or flat light green on living tissue, often with dull spots. Yellow on cane begonias more often follows wet-root failure, cold damage, or aging lower leaves turning fully yellow before drop. If the pot is heavy and lowers are limp yellow, read overwatering; if blades look lime-green but still firm, start with light and nutrient checks.

Will pale Begonia Maculata leaves turn dark green again?

Existing angel-wing blades that have washed out rarely regain full color or crisp silver dots. Recovery shows in the next two or three new leaves from cane nodes—darker green, stronger spotting, and closer internodes. Judge success by new growth, not by old pale tissue you can prune once the plant stabilizes.

Should I fertilize pale Begonia Maculata right away?

Not until you confirm bright indirect light and a healthy dry-down rhythm. Fertilizer on a dim, waterlogged begonia can worsen salt stress when roots already struggle to take up water. If light and moisture look right and only older mid-cane leaves pale while new tips stay weak, consider dilute balanced feed during active growth—not in winter dormancy.

How do I prevent pale leaves on Begonia Maculata?

Place the plant within a couple of feet of an east- or west-facing window with no hot midday sun on the foliage, water only when the top 2–3 cm of mix dries, and keep humidity at or above 50% in heated rooms. Rotate the pot weekly so all cane sides receive even light, and inspect leaf undersides for mites before assuming chlorosis.
